Abstract

The invention discloses a debugging test bed for a cutting device of a digging and anchoring machine. The debugging test bed comprises a mounting rack, a waterway system, a hydraulic system and an electrical control system. The mounting rack comprises a base and a cutting device positioning structure fixed on the base. The electrical control system comprises a starter assembly and a main control device, the starter assembly, the waterway system and the hydraulic system are all electrically connected to the main control device, and the main control device is used for controlling the starter assembly to start so as to control operation of a cutting motor of the cutting device and controlling the waterway system to start so as to supply water to a spraying device of the cutting device, and is used for controlling the hydraulic system to start so as to control the operation of a roller hydraulic cylinder of the cutting device. The cutting motor, the cutting speed reducer, the spraying device and the roller hydraulic cylinder of the cutting device can be debugged and tested through the tunneling anchor machine cutting device debugging test bed, independent debugging and testing of the cutting device can be achieved, and the tunneling anchor machine debugging efficiency can be improved.

Description

technical field [0001] The invention relates to the technical field of special equipment for coal mines, in particular to a debugging test bench for a cutting device of a bolter miner. Background technique [0002] The all-in-one machine for digging and bolting is a special equipment for tunneling in coal mines, which can realize synchronous operations of tunneling and support. The cutting device 8 (that is, the cutting head) is the most important part of the integrated bolter-digging machine to realize the excavation operation, and its performance and reliability are directly related to the overall performance and reliability of the integrated bolter-digger machine.
